Sandwich slimming tips
City girls usually grab lunch on the run. The most popular choices salads, soups (more about those foods later!) and sandwiches. Sandwiches are probably the most convenient lunch because you can eat them quickly and they are sold almost everywhere… from your corner deli or gourmet sandwich shop. They can be a great choice, or the worst. Calories range from 375 - 800 plus!The problem with most deli or gourmet sandwiches is that they are overstuffed and contain high fat ingredients such as mayo, cheese, pesto, Russian dressing, etc. Some sandwiches are also made on breads that are deceptively high in calories.
Here are some quick tips to slim your sandwich:
Problem: Beware of high calorie high fat condiments. They can add over 300 calories to a sandwich. The following portions are the typical amounts added to a sandwich. For example:
cheese (2 oz) =200 cal / 18 gm fat
regular mayo (2 T.) = 200 cal / 22 gm fat
Russian dressiing (2 T.)120 cal / 10 gm fat
Solution:Try these low calorie low fat condiments instead: lettuce, tomato, other veggies, mustard - plain or flavored, BBQ sauce, ketchup, roasted peppers, hot peppers. Avocado is somewhat high in calories, however it is still a good choice as it contain heart healthy fats. If you love cheese, try to limit it on a sandwich to only once a week, or ask for only one slice (100 calories per one oz slice). Having lettuce, tomato and mustard instead of cheese and mayo can save you 400 calories and 40 grams of fat!
Problem: Many sandwiches are overstuffed and may contain 7 oz of filling (600 calories or more - not including the bread!).
Solution: Try to remove some of the filling or better yet, eat only half. Eating half of the sandwich will allow you to enjoy one of your favorite “fattening” sandwiches on occasion! A good compromise would be to order 1/2 sandwich and a low calorie soup.
Problem: High calorie breads
Solution: Select breads that are lower in calories. Here is a comparison of different breads:
2 slices of regular bread =160 calories **
bread =300 calories
wrap bread = 240 calories
Kaiser roll = 240 calories
Medium pita = 160 calories**
2 slices of light bread = 80 calories**
bagel = 320-500 calories (80 calories per ounce)
Cosi (one slice bread) = 265 calories
** Best low calorie choices
*Try to select whole grain breads if possible to increase your fiber and nutrient intake.
Problem: Do not let the name fool you! Sandwiches made with fish or chicken are not necessarily low calorie.Both of these Au Bon Pain sandwiches - chicken tarragon with romaine sandwich and Arizona chicken sandwich on sundried tomato bread - pack in over 625 calories and 29 grams of fat.
Solution: Check out all the ingredients in the sandwich. If possible, try to obtain the calorie content on line. Healthy sounding sandwiches are not necessarily low in calories and fat!
